Single-family homes, bungalows, and cottages built in Quebec since the 1960s are very commonly topped with prefabricated roof trusses (also known as engineered roof framing). Designed in a factory using sophisticated structural calculation software, these wood assemblies joined with toothed metal connector plates provide excellent strength while remaining lightweight and cost-effective.
As a family’s needs evolve, homeowners may want to make use of the unused space beneath the roof. Whether the goal is to create a bright cathedral ceiling in the living room, convert the attic into a bedroom, add a dormer, or install a large skylight, modifying the roof’s load-bearing structure requires careful structural planning.
Design snow loads vary considerably from one region of Quebec to another. A roof’s required load capacity is calculated based on local climate data and factors such as roof slope, wind exposure, roof geometry, and potential snow accumulation. Cutting, drilling, or modifying any component of a truss without prior assessment can reduce its structural capacity and compromise the way the system is designed to perform.
Why Modify a Roof Truss, and What Are the Risks?

An engineered roof truss does not work the same way as traditional roof framing built piece by piece on site. It is a closed, triangulated system in which each wood component plays a specific and interdependent role under tension and compression forces.
Each component contributes to the overall structural balance:
Top chord: The sloped wood members that form the roof pitch. They work mainly in compression under the weight of the roofing material and snow.
Bottom chord: The horizontal member forming the lower portion of the truss, which may support the ceiling below the roof. It works in tension to help prevent the exterior walls from spreading outward.
Web members or diagonals: The interior pieces forming the triangulated “W” or “V” pattern. They help transfer loads toward the exterior load-bearing walls.
Cutting a web member, chord, or connector can change the way forces are distributed through the truss. Depending on the component affected and the loads involved, this can cause deformation, cracks in interior finishes, and, in more serious situations, compromise the stability of the roof.
Modifying a Roof Truss for an Attic Conversion or Cathedral Ceiling
Homeowners generally consider roof-framing modifications in three common situations.
Attic Conversion
Goal: Convert unused attic space into a bedroom, office, or playroom.
Approach: Have a new structural configuration designed to create usable space, potentially using reinforcements, beams, and additional load-bearing elements determined by the structural designer.
Creating a Cathedral Ceiling
Goal: Alter the flat ceiling to open the space up to the underside of the roof.
Approach: To create a cathedral ceiling, the existing structure must be recalculated and adapted. Depending on the building, the solution may include a structural ridge beam, additional beams and posts, or replacing certain trusses with a specially designed configuration.
Adding a Dormer or Large Skylight
Goal: Bring in more natural light and increase usable headroom.
Approach: Creating an opening may require interrupting certain trusses and redistributing their loads using headers and reinforced adjacent trusses or framing members, according to the structural plans.

When Do You Need an Engineer to Modify a Roof Truss?

In Quebec, modifying a prefabricated roof truss is not simply a carpentry job. It is regulated by the Engineers Act and the Quebec Construction Code.
Legal Requirements
A roof-truss modification must be designed so that the roof maintains its structural capacity. Depending on the type of building, the extent of the modification, the proposed solution, and municipal requirements, structural calculations and plans prepared by an engineer may be required.
Manufacturer’s Warranty
The manufacturer’s warranty may be affected if the truss is modified from its original design.
Any modification should be designed or validated by an engineer to help ensure structural compliance.
A contractor or carpenter must perform the work in accordance with the applicable structural design. When a design or calculation activity is reserved under the Engineers Act, it must be carried out by an engineer who is a member of the OIQ.
What Is Included in the Engineer’s Report and Sealed Plans?
When you hire an engineer to assess your roof, the process generally involves several steps:
Site inspection and existing-condition survey: The engineer inspects the attic to measure lumber sizes, truss spacing usually 16 or 24 inches on centre, the condition of the metal connectors, and the span between load-bearing walls.
Structural modelling and load calculations: Using structural calculation software, the engineer assesses how the roof performs under local snow loads, wind loads, and the weight of new materials such as insulation, drywall, or flooring.
Preparation of modification plans: When required, the engineer prepares structural plans showing the elements to be modified or reinforced, their dimensions, the materials to be used, and the necessary connections and fasteners.
Engineer’s seal: The engineer stamps their official seal and digital signature on the plans. Signed and sealed plans can then be included with the municipal permit application when required. The municipality issues the permit after reviewing the application.
Depending on the plans for the specific project, the work may include temporary shoring of the roof, adding new framing members or beams, reinforcing certain connections, and carefully removing existing components. Dimensions, materials, connectors, and installation sequences must follow the applicable structural plans.
Obtaining a Municipal Renovation Permit in Quebec

A structural modification to a roof will generally require a municipal permit. However, the requirements and documents requested vary by municipality, so check with your local planning department before work begins.
Depending on the municipality and the scope of the work, the permit application may include:
The completed permit application form.
A certificate of location.
Plans showing the existing and proposed conditions.
Structural plans, when required.
Information about the contractor.
Risks associated with carrying out work without the required municipal permit include:
The possibility of a municipal stop-work order.
Fines imposed under applicable municipal bylaws.
Undeclared or non-compliant work potentially complicating an insurance claim, depending on the circumstances and policy conditions.
Significant complications when selling the property.
Taking administrative shortcuts with structural work can put your investment at risk. When the property is sold, the seller’s declaration may require you to disclose structural work completed without a permit. This can raise questions during the transaction, require additional inspections, or require the owner to have the work legalized or corrected.
How Much Does It Cost to Modify a Roof Truss in Quebec?

The total budget for modifying a roof truss generally includes three main components: professional engineering fees, municipal permit fees, and the cost of framing materials and labour.
Engineer’s fees (OIQ): $1,000 to $2,500
Municipal renovation permit: $100 to $500
Framing materials and labour (RBQ contractor): $2,500 to $10,000
Estimated total budget: $3,600 to $13,000+

Engineer’s Fees and Municipal Permit Costs
Engineering fees vary depending on the architectural complexity of the home and whether original building plans are available.
Professional / Administrative Service | Indicative Price Range | Factors Affecting Cost |
Initial inspection and attic survey | $400 to $800 | Travel distance, attic accessibility, unavailable original plans |
Structural calculations and sealed plans (OIQ) | $800 to $1,800 | Complexity of load redistribution, addition of LVL beams |
Post-construction site inspection (optional) | $300 to $600 | Issuance of a final compliance letter for the municipality |
Municipal renovation permit fees | $100 to $500 | Municipal bylaw, fixed fee, or percentage of the value of the work |
Indicative Cost Ranges by Type of Project
The cost of the work depends heavily on the nature of the project. Modifying two or three roof trusses to add a dormer is significantly less expensive than modifying the entire roof structure to create a cathedral ceiling in an open-concept space.
Indicative framing costs by project type:
Local Modification (Skylight/Dormer)
Scope: 2 to 4 roof trusses affected.
Cost of work: $2,500 to $4,500, including materials and labour.
Partial Modification (Limited Attic Conversion)
Scope: Reinforcing bottom chords and installing gussets over a 15- to 20-foot section.
Cost of work: $4,500 to $8,000.
Major Transformation (Full Cathedral Ceiling)
Scope: Major structural reconfiguration involving a structural ridge beam and/or modified trusses, based on the engineer’s design.
Cost of work: $8,000 to $15,000+.
Material choices also have a significant impact on the final cost:
Engineered wood beams (LVL/Microllam): Approximately $15 to $35 per linear foot, depending on size.
Gussets and 3/4-inch plywood: Approximately $45 to $65 per 4 × 8-foot sheet.
Heavy-duty steel connectors: Approximately $5 to $25 each, depending on load capacity.

Choosing an RBQ-Licensed General Contractor

Modifying a load-bearing roof structure requires careful execution. Improper handling during temporary shoring can cause ceilings below to crack or allow the roof structure to shift, potentially resulting in water infiltration and other damage.
In Quebec, make sure the company you hire holds a valid licence issued by the Régie du bâtiment du Québec (RBQ) with the appropriate subclassifications:
Subclass 1.2: Contractor — Small Buildings
Subclass 1.3: Contractor — Buildings of All Kinds
Checklist for choosing your contractor:
Verify the RBQ licence number in the public registry.
Confirm that the contractor carries adequate liability insurance.
Require the work to be completed in accordance with the engineer’s plans and requirements.
Verify which contractual and legal warranties apply to the framing work.
Article 2118 of the Civil Code of Québec provides, under certain conditions, for five-year liability related to the loss of the work resulting from a defect in design, construction, or performance, or from a defect in the soil. This legal liability is separate from the contractor’s obligation to hold the required RBQ licences.
